Choosing the Right Window Screens to Keep Bugs Out

When it comes to selecting window screens, you’ll find a range of options, each suited to specific needs. Choosing the right type of screen helps keep unwanted bugs out, while also allowing you to enjoy natural ventilation. Here are some common types:

  • Fiberglass Screens: Durable, flexible, and budget-friendly, these screens are ideal for general insect protection.
  • Aluminum Screens: Known for their strength and durability, aluminum screens withstand harsh weather but can be more visible.
  • Pet-Resistant Screens: These screens are thicker and more resistant to tears, perfect if you have pets prone to scratching.
  • Solar Screens: Designed to block UV rays, solar screens can also help keep bugs out while reducing heat gain in your home.

Measuring and Installing Window Screens for Maximum Bug Protection

Proper installation is key to ensuring that your window screens effectively block bugs. Follow these steps to get a snug, secure fit:

  1. Measure the Window Frame: Use a tape measure to find the exact height and width of your window frame. Add a small margin to ensure a secure fit if your screen will be inserted into a frame.
  2. Choose Your Screen Material: Based on your home’s specific needs, select the material and type of screen you’ll install.
  3. Cut the Screen to Size: Carefully cut the screen to fit your window dimensions, leaving some extra material on each side if you’ll be fitting it into a frame.
  4. Attach to the Frame: If you’re using a frame, secure the screen to it, making sure it’s pulled taut to prevent any gaps where bugs could enter.
  5. Install the Frame in the Window: Finally, place the frame into your window, ensuring that it’s securely held in place.

With the right installation process, your window screens should serve as a reliable barrier against unwanted bugs.
